mbv 2nd January 2010 12:04 PM

The Omen....so pissed off with this. Basically same script with a laptop and mobile phone thrown in there to make it modern. The kid was just too evil(the originals kid was just a kid that didn't know what was going on, because he was A KID) this little shit was trying to burn a hole in peoples head with his devil eyes. Grrrrr

Wicker Man....Horrible movie. 'Step away from the bicycle' An absolute insult to the classic.

Friday the 13th....An MTV style slasher with a bloke in a hockey mask killing them.On paper it probably looked like they had all the typical F13 elements in there(T&A, stupid teens, constructive deaths) but it just didn't work at all. This is the most annoyed I've ever been in the cinema EVER.

Halloween....Gutted by this as I loved Zombies previous 2. Not scary at all, unless you are afraid of sudden loud music. The white trash Myers was the downfall of this movie. Took all the mystery out of MM's character.

pedromonkey 2nd January 2010 02:17 PM

ALL THE BOYS LOVE MANDY LANE - Beautiful people and well shot vista's cannot compensate for a mindnumbingly tedious plot that reveals it's twist by accident within the first five minutes, a truly awful film.

PROM NIGHT (Remake) - the dumbing down of horror continues with this bloodless, MTV style teen 'slasher' that fails to muster up any tension. Awful.

BLACK CHRISTMAS (Remake) - Fox take on Bob Clarke's 1974 xmas slasher opus with unbelievable amaturism. The cast are ok but the dialog is awful. bad bad bad!!!!!!!!!!!

TEXAS CHAINSAW MASSASCR: THE BEGINING - one question. WHY? CRAPtacular. a waste of money.

QUARANTINE - why did america remake [rec], why? they filmed it shot for shot and just changed the language from spanish to english, they could have saved money by dubbing [rec].
